Frankenthaler, a pivotal figure in post-war American art, was celebrated for her groundbreaking "soak-stain" technique, a revolutionary approach that involved pouring thinned paint directly onto unprimed canvas, allowing the pigments to literally soak into the fabric, becoming one with the support rather than resting on its surface. This method yielded luminous, ethereal fields of color that appeared to float and merge organically, blurring the lines between painting and drawing, and challenging traditional notions of artistic creation.
